This individual will be responsible for defining, delivering, and supporting customer identity and access management (IAM) solutions with a focus on Ping Directory and related Ping Identity products. The candidate will collaborate closely with the IT Engineering and Information Security teams to design scalable, secure, and high-performance directory services. They will also contribute to broader IS initiatives and support ongoing operations within the Information Security department.

The candidate will be focused on securing identity infrastructure through the implementation and management of Ping Directory and associated tools. Responsibilities include directory architecture, schema design, replication strategies, performance tuning, and integration with authentication and authorization systems.

ESSENTIAL D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ES:
  • Design, implement, and maintain Ping Directory infrastructure to support customer identity services.
  • Define security and performance requirements for directory services and IAM integrations.
  • Serve as a subject matter expert and consultant on identity-related projects.
  • Collaborate with IT and IS teams to integrate Ping Directory with authentication, SSO, and federation solutions.
  • Monitor and optimize directory performance, replication, and availability.
  • Develop and maintain standards, procedures, and guidelines for directory services and IAM operations.
  • Conduct root cause analysis and remediation of identity-related incidents and vulnerabilities.
  • Support audits and compliance efforts by providing technical documentation and evidence of controls.
  • Stay current with identity security threats, technologies, and best practices.
  • Participate in risk assessments and recommend improvements to identity infrastructure.
  • Provide technical leadership and mentoring to junior engineers and offshore teams.


Experience Requirements:
MINIMUM KNOWLEDGE, SKILLS & ABILITIES REQUIRED:
  • Bachelor's degree in computer science, Information Systems, or equivalent experience. Master's degree a plus.
  • 8+ years of IT experience, with at least 4 years focused on Ping Directory or similar LDAP-based directory services.
  • Strong understanding of identity and access management principles, including authentication, authorization, and federation.
  • Experience with Ping Identity suite (PingDirectory, PingFederate, PingAccess, PingOne).
  • Experience consuming and integrating on prem or hybrid cloud to AWS (or similar cloud platform).
  • Proficiency in Unix/Linux.
  • Familiarity with scripting languages (e.g., Shell, Python) for automation and integration.
  • Solid understanding of distributed computing and directory replication strategies.
  • Knowledge of application and data security concepts and common vulnerabilities.
  • Experience working with offshore teams and in regulated industries (e.g., financial services) is a plus.
  • Industry certifications such as CompTIA Security+, CISSP, or Ping Identity certifications preferred.
  • Excellent communication skills, both verbal and written, with the ability to tailor messaging to technical and non-technical audiences.
